The Right Amount of Ice
Ice plays a critical role in the texture, temperature, and dilution rate of our drinks. Here’s how to manage it:
- Iced Lattes, Teas and Lemonades: For these, fill the cup to the top of the logo on the iced cup. This ratio ensures the latte is chilled and flavorful without becoming too watered down as the ice melts.
- Iced Americanos and Frappes: Fill these cups to the brim with ice. The extra ice complements the stronger flavours of americanos and helps thicken up frappes, while maintaining a cold, refreshing consistency longer.
- Exception: If a customer asks for a specific amount of ice in their drink, it’s always best to make it to their liking.
Layering for Optimal Flavour
Layering correctly enhances both the visual appeal and the taste of each drink. Here’s the approach:
- Start with Ice: Based on the drink, add ice to either 3/4 full or to the brim of the cup. This initial layer sets the stage for a refreshingly cold beverage.
- Add Milk (for Lattes): Pour milk over the ice. The cold milk interacts with the ice, beginning the chilling process without immediate dilution. If espresso is added first, the ice will begin to melt, creating a watered-down drink.
- Espresso or Matcha on Top: For lattes add your espresso or matcha last. This method allows the hot beverage to cool gradually, creating a smooth, integrated flavour as it mixes with the milk and ice.
Syrup Integration Techniques
Avoid having syrup sit at the bottom of the cup as pictured above.
Mix syrup with your base prior to pouring it over milk to keep the cascading effect.
To ensure syrups contribute to the drink’s flavour profile without sinking to the bottom, follow these tips:
- Mix Before Ice : For drinks where syrup flavour is paramount, mix the syrup with the espresso or matcha base before pouring it over the ice. This approach guarantees flavour consistency from the first sip to the last.
- Stir Well: If adding syrup after the ice, make sure to stir the drink thoroughly but gently from the bottom up. This method helps distribute the syrup evenly while maintaining the integrity of the layered look.
